Tech - Finance Business Partner - £90-100k + bonus - London with European travel
A global technology business is looking to appoint a commercially focused Finance Business Partner to support its Product organisation.
This is a fantastic opportunity for a strong finance business partner to join a highly visible commercial finance team and partner senior Product stakeholders within a fast-paced, international business. The role will play a key part in evaluating investment opportunities, shaping product strategy and ensuring resources are allocated effectively to drive growth and profitability.
The successful candidate will act as a trusted advisor to non-finance stakeholders, helping translate financial insight into better business decisions.
The Opportunity
Working closely with Product leaders, Technology teams and wider commercial stakeholders, you will provide financial support across a range of strategic initiatives, new product developments and investment decisions.

This role is ideal for someone who enjoys combining financial analysis with commercial problem-solving and wants to move beyond traditional reporting into a genuine business partnering position.
Responsibilities
- Partner Product Directors and Product Managers on strategic and operational decision-making.
- Build and evaluate business cases for new products, product enhancements and investment opportunities.
- Deliver financial modelling, scenario analysis and investment appraisals.
- Support budgeting, forecasting and long-term planning activities.
- Analyse product performance, margins, revenue streams and return on investment.
- Provide commercial insight and challenge to support decision-making.
- Monitor and report on key financial and operational KPIs.
- Support prioritisation of product initiatives and resource allocation decisions.
- Work cross-functionally with Technology, Operations and Commercial teams.
- Identify opportunities to improve financial performance and drive value creation.
- Present findings and recommendations to senior stakeholders.

About You
- ACA, ACCA or CIMA qualified.
- Typically 3-5 years PQE.
- Experience within Finance Business Partnering, Commercial Finance or FP&A.
- Strong financial modelling and business case experience.
- Previous exposure to Product, Technology, Digital or Commercial functions would be highly advantageous.
- Comfortable challenging and influencing non-finance stakeholders.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ving capability.
- Excellent communication and relationship-building skills.
- Experience within a technology, software, fintech, telecoms or other product-led environment would be beneficial.
- Able to operate effectively within a fast-paced, complex organisation.
